If build agents in the Forgeline pool drift more than 30 seconds apart, signed artifacts start failing verification — that's usually why this page fires. First, check the NTP sync status on the agent dashboard and restart chrony on stragglers. If skew persists past two restarts, escalate to the infra timekeeping owners.

escalation mailbox, bafog-fafog: ulador@paliqlabs.internal

Subject: Tracing setup for the Quillbrook integration

Hi, and welcome aboard. As you wire your services into the Quillbrook mesh, please propagate our trace header on every outbound call, including retries — dropped headers are the main reason spans appear orphaned in the Lanternview dashboard. Sampling is set to 20% in staging, so don't panic if some requests vanish. To query the trace API directly while you're validating your integration, authenticate with the token below.

login token, yagaf-hawip: eyJhbGciOiJIUzI1NiIsInR5cCI6IkpXVCJ9.eyJzdWIiOiIdHjlcNIn0.AFyH-u9q

# Runbook: Hunting leaked file descriptors in Quillgate

When the `fd_open` gauge climbs steadily between deploys, suspect a leak rather than load. First confirm on a single pod: exec in and count entries under `/proc/1/fd`, noting how many are sockets in CLOSE_WAIT versus regular files. Capture two snapshots ten minutes apart before restarting anything — we need the delta for the postmortem. Reproduce locally with the Marbury load harness, which requires the service running with the following configuration values.

settings of yagep-bajog:
[istdor]
port = 4000
region = south-2
host = istdor.qorvelcorp.internal
timeout_ms = 5000
retries = 5